## Runbook: Coinframe 5.1 — currency rounding fix

Quick context for whoever inherits this: pre-5.1, conversions in Coinframe rounded at each intermediate step, so multi-hop conversions could drift by a cent or two. Now we carry full precision internally and round once at display time. Ledger totals from old and new builds won't match exactly — that's expected, don't "fix" it by reintroducing per-step rounding. Migration replays are idempotent, so re-running is safe. Before promoting the build, verify the artifact signature with the key below.

rollout seal: bky4_x7Gc

While replacing the homegrown job queue with Conveyly, we found that staging and prod diverged: prod still carries retry settings from the old Taskmire workers, while staging was updated during the pilot. This caused the duplicate-dispatch bug reported by the Ostrander team last week. Proposed fix: delete the legacy overrides and standardize both environments on a single reviewed baseline. Please review the values below before we apply them to prod. The agreed baseline configuration is as follows.

settings of yageg-yahap:
[gorael]
team = olieth
access_code = ac_941d74
owner = brieth.aldiel
host = gorael.tolvaqio.internal
port = 6379
peer = briwyn.urlaqtech.internal
salt = 116e6622
pin = 1957

Transcode farm note for Pellwright release cut: the Fenroc workers started failing mezzanine jobs after Tuesday's base image bump. Root cause was the codec pack pinning loose in the farm bootstrap, so half the fleet picked up a newer muxer that rejects our legacy container flags. Fix is to pin the pack in the Drossel manifest and redeploy workers in waves. Staging ran clean overnight. The validated worker image is traceable by the token below.

trace token, kahog-tajeg: htk6_97d963

### Step 2: Confirm SDK Parity Before Tagging

Before cutting a release of the Mirelle client SDKs, confirm feature parity between the Kotlin and Swift implementations. Run `parity-check --matrix` against the shared spec repo; any red cells block the tag. Known gaps (offline queueing, batch uploads) are tracked on the Harrowfield board and are acceptable only if flagged in the release notes. Once parity passes, tag both repos with the same version and publish from the Lanternway runner. Sign the release artifacts using the key below.

signing key of bagap-yawep = bky13_TbfT6ZMUoGJo2